5 Effective Mesothelioma Diet Tips
Mesothelioma treatment can play havoc with your digestive system. The side effects of mesothelioma treatments can include nausea, loss of appetite, diarrhea, or constipation. You may feel too tired or sick to eat much. If you don’t get enough nutrition during mesothelioma treatment, however, you can grow even more fatigued and you may start to lose muscle mass. A healthy mesothelioma diet can help you feel better and stay active. Here are 5 mesothelioma diet tips to help you strengthen your body for its fight against mesothelioma cancer. 1. Study Says Avoid Antioxidants In Your Mesothelioma Diet
Because there is no known cure for mesothelioma, many people who have this form of cancer turn to alternative therapies in hopes of staying healthier for longer. Healthy eating is one simple approach that many cancer patients take to strengthen their immune systems. Foods containing antioxidants have long been touted as beneficial components of a mesothelioma diet. A spate of scientific studies on humans has cast doubt on this and a 2015 study of mice with melanoma suggests that antioxidants may actually help cancer cells grow and metastasize. Cancer Weight Training: Why It Helps
Cancer and weight training have not always been words you would see in the same sentence. The old school of thought was that cancer patients during treatment and recovery needed to rest not test their muscles. Now thanks to greater attention to optimizing wellness for cancer patients we now know that weight training done within reasonable limits and with a physician’s approval can help not hinder cancer patients.
